    What is a Surge Protector?

    At its core, a surge protector is a device designed to protect electronic devices from voltage spikes. These spikes, or surges, can come from various sources, such as lightning strikes, power outages, or even the turning on and off of high-power appliances. Without a surge protector, these surges can cause significant damage to your electronics, leading to costly repairs or replacements. Think of your surge protector as the unsung hero guarding your gadgets from unexpected electrical villains!

    A surge protector works by diverting excess voltage away from your devices. Inside the surge protector, there are components called metal oxide varistors (MOVs). These MOVs are designed to short-circuit excess voltage to the grounding wire, thereby preventing it from reaching your devices. When the voltage is within a normal range, the MOVs remain inactive, allowing electricity to flow normally. But when a surge occurs, the MOVs kick into action, diverting the extra voltage safely. Different surge protectors offer varying levels of protection, measured in joules. The higher the joule rating, the more energy the surge protector can absorb, and the better it protects your devices.

    Performance and Protection

    When it comes to surge protectors, performance and protection are paramount. The iEtherial Helios is designed to deliver reliable surge protection, but how well does it actually perform? One of the key metrics to consider is its clamping voltage. The clamping voltage is the maximum voltage that the surge protector will allow to pass through to your devices. A lower clamping voltage is better because it means the surge protector is more effective at diverting excess voltage.

    The iEtherial Helios typically has a low clamping voltage, ensuring that your devices are well-protected from voltage spikes. It also boasts a fast response time, meaning it can quickly react to surges and divert the excess voltage before it reaches your electronics. This fast response time is crucial because even a brief surge can cause damage to sensitive components.
